STM32L433CCU6TR Description

The STM32L433CCU6TR is a low-power microcontroller from STMicroelectronics, designed for a wide range of applications that require high energy efficiency and performance. This microcontroller is based on the high-performance Arm Cortex-M4 32-bit RISC core, operating at a frequency of up to 80 MHz.

Description:

The STM32L433CCU6TR is a member of the STM32L4 series, which is known for its low-power capabilities and advanced features. This microcontroller is available in a compact UFQFPN package, making it suitable for space-constrained applications.

Features:

  1. Core: Arm Cortex-M4 32-bit RISC core with a maximum frequency of 80 MHz.
  2. Memory: 256 KB of Flash memory and 64 KB of RAM.
  3. Low Power: Ultra-low power consumption with a wide range of low-power modes, making it ideal for battery-powered applications.
  4. Connectivity: Advanced communication interfaces, including I2C, SPI, USART, and UART.
  5. Timers: Multiple timers, including a 16-bit advanced-control timer and a 32-bit timer, for various timekeeping and control applications.
  6. ADC: 1x 12-bit ADC with up to 16 channels for accurate analog-to-digital conversion.
  7. DAC: 1x 12-bit DAC for digital-to-analog conversion.
  8. Security: Features like a hardware unique ID, a hardware cryptographic processor, and secure boot options.
  9. Package: UFQFPN package with a total of 48 pins.
